4. Mattiastrum howardii Kazmi in J. Arn. Arb.  52:129.  1971.   
YASIN J. NASIR
 
 
 
 
Closely related to Mattiastrum himalayense, but annual or lets ofter bienaial; with an indumentum of subpatent hairs only and with a longer style. 
 
Fl. Per.: May-June. 
Type: Gilgit: Astor, 7800', 25.7.1892, Duthie s.n. (BM, isotype E).  
Distribution: Endemic to Gilgit area (Pakistan).
